python獲取程式碼執行時間
有的時候,操作大檔案,或者取數,要很久,我們給指令碼首尾新增一段程式碼就知道,這段程式碼整體的大致執行時間了。
import time
start =time.clock()
#中間寫上程式碼塊
end = time.clock()
print('Running time: %s Seconds'%(end-start))
執行結果會是這樣:
In [2]: %run F:\\celueji\\python_script\\sheetcopy_RuleRepor.py
...:
Running time: 443.52740769630543 Seconds
彩蛋:使用%run可以執行本地的python指令碼,語法為
%run path
path為本地檔案路徑
相關推薦
python獲取程式碼執行時間
有的時候,操作大檔案,或者取數,要很久,我們給指令碼首尾新增一段程式碼就知道,這段程式碼整體的大致執行時間了。 import time start =time.clock() #中間寫上程式碼塊
python計算程式碼執行時間的裝飾器
import time def cal_time(func): def wrapper(*args, **kwargs): t1 = time.time() result = func(*args, **kwargs) t2 =
檢視python中程式碼執行時間
要檢視python的執行時間,可以呼叫time函式來實現 用法程式碼如下: import time start = time() """ ###要檢視的程式碼部分### """ end = time() print("Running time: %
python測量程式碼執行時間方法
Python 社群有句俗語: “python自己帶著電池” ,別自己寫計時框架。 Python3.2具備一個叫做 timeit 的完美計時工具可以測量python程式碼的執行時間。 timeit 模組 timeit 模組定義了接受兩個引數的 Timer 類
java獲取某段程式碼執行時間和js獲取方法執行時間
java獲取某段程式碼執行時間和js獲取方法執行時間 java // 測試執行時間 long startTime = System.currentTimeMillis(); 程式碼段...... // 結束時間 long endTime = Syst
python某段程式碼執行時間過長,如何跳過執行下一步?
在工作中遇到過 個問題 執行一條程式碼時間過長 而且還不報錯,卡死在那。還要繼續執行下面程式碼,如何操作。 下面是個簡單的例項 pip安裝 第三方eventlet這個包 import time import eventlet#匯入eventlet這個模組 eventlet.monke
Python 程式碼執行時間的3種計算方法
方法1 ? 1 2 3 4 5 import datetime starttime = datetime.datetime.now() #long runnin
python+opencv計算程式碼執行時間:time庫和opencv自帶方法getTickCount
import cv2 import time ############################## 利用opencv的兩個函式進行時間耗費計算 # cv2.getTickCount()記錄當前
分別利用timeit和time模組測試python程式碼執行時間
在python中,當我們想測試一段程式碼的執行時間時,可以利用python的timeit模組和time模組。這兩個模組在功能上都可以實現對程式碼執行時間的計算,但是本文推薦使用的是timeit模組,因為其是專門用來測試程式碼執行時間的,有一些靈活的方法,並且相對
常用的三種獲取程式執行時間的方法
chrono 參考教程:http://www.cnblogs.com/jwk000/p/3560086.html #include <chrono> //C++11 chrono::steady_clock::time_point t1 = chro
PHP獲取程式執行時間
/** * @desc 獲取程式執行時間 * @param bool $time @傳此引數,代表獲取執行時間,不傳返回當前時間 * @param bool $format @當傳第一個引數時,此引數才起作用:是否返回字串ms * @param bool $numbe
算出程式碼執行時間
1 #include <bits/stdc++.h> 2 #define maxn 1000005 3 4 typedef long long ll; 5 6 using namespace std; 7 8 clock_t start,stop; 9 10 ll
一些巨集替換用法,使程式碼更加精煉。總結了兩個,一個foreach,用來c++容器遍歷,一個計算程式碼執行時間的。
一:#ifndef foreach #define foreach(container,it) \ for(typeof((container).begin()) it = (container).begin();it != (container).end() ;++it) #endif
python 獲取 多執行緒的返回值
import time import threading class MyThread(threading.Thread): def __init__(self, target=None, args=(), **kwargs): super(MyThread
日誌中每段程式碼執行時間的和不等於整段程式碼執行的總時間
程式碼邏輯: def getInlink() A -> B -> C -> D 在tornado中呼
Linux應用程式開發筆記:測試程式碼執行時間
#include <stdio.h> #include <sys/times.h> #include <unistd.h> void main(void) { double duration; clock_t start,
StopWatch計算程式碼執行時間
StopWatch sw = new StopWatch(); sw.start("任意取名1"); 要計算的操作程式碼1 sw.stop(); System.out.println(sw.prettyPrin
python3列印當前時間和獲取程式執行時間
學習使用time模組和datetime模組。 通常我們想讓程式等待幾秒鐘,再繼續向下執行,time模組的sleep()方法是一個很好的選擇。但是想通過time模組列印系統的當前時間,則比較麻煩。如下: from time import strftime, localtime # 列印當前時間 de
C#獲取程式執行時間
DateTime dt0 = DateTime.Now; //此處寫耗時的執行函式 DateTime dt1 = DateTime.Now; TimeSpan ts = dt1.Subtract(dt0)
python獲取當前日期時間
轉載自:https://www.cnblogs.com/wenBlog/p/6023742.html 在Python裡如何獲取當前的日期和時間呢?在Python語言裡,我們可以通過呼叫什麼模組或者類函式來得到當前的時間或日期呢? 當然你可以使用時間模組(time module),該模組提供了各種和時間相關